When Russian architectural studio Ruetemple got a brief from a client to create a weekend house where their little ones would be easily entertained while mum and dad got to relax, this is what they came up with.
They went and built a playground above the parents' bed.
Sticking to a calming timber and white motif, the designers have created the perfect escape for the kids, even with access to a secret room, a podium with a bed, two upper levels and a staircase complete with white nets to protect the children from falling while allowing them to climb to the very top of the fortress.
The house is, according to design and architecture website Dezeen, used as a summer and weekend home by the family.
And when Mum and Dad want a sleep in after a long work week, their two children can climb and play without disturbing their parents.
